Disc brakes
The prerequisite for all the various electronic active safety systems is a high-performance brake system. All Mercedes-Benz Vans are therefore equipped with a state-of-the-art dual-circuit brake system with disc brakes on all wheels.
Driving safety systems
Electronic driving safety systems ensure the attainment of a high level of active and passive safety. They include the ESP®, ABS ASR, BAS and EBD systems.
Electronic Brake Force Distribution (EBD)
Electronic Brake Force Distribution (EBD) proportions the braking force between the front and rear wheels of the van as required in order to optimise braking efficiency in all driving situations. In this way the system prevents “overbraking” of the rear wheels, which could cause the tail to break loose. At the same time EBD puts less stress on the front brakes, which reduces the risk of fading due to overheating.
Equipment packages
Optional, specialised equipment packages provide additional safety for Mercedes-Benz Vans. The TOP LOAD package includes roof rails for a weight up to 150 kg, a ladder rack with rollers and a tie-down set (available for the Vito). The CARGO package contains a wooden floor with an integrated track system, side wall anchoring track as well as straps and lugs for attaching the load (available for the Vito).
Ergonomically designed driving area
An ergonomically designed driving area is vital for a driver to maintain concentration and stay focussed and alert. Comfortable multi-adjustable seats and an adjustable steering column allow drivers to quickly and easily find their ideal seating position. The cockpit includes many design features that take the stress out of driving: a clearly designed and laid out instrument panel, glare-free instruments that are easily readable both at day and night, and easy-reach, logically structured controls.

Electronic Stability Program ESP®
ESP® improves the driver's control over the vehicle in certain critical situations – for example if there is a risk of skidding ESP® compares the vehicle's intended direction with its actual track. If there is a discrepancy between the driver's instructions and the vehicle's reactions, the system takes corrective action instantly, either by reducing the engine power or by selective actuation of one or more brakes, as required. ESP® combines the functions of the anti-lock braking system (ABS), acceleration skid control (ASR) and Brake Assist (BAS), to which it also adds a stability aid.
Note: ESP® can only act within the laws of physics. If the driver exceeds these limits, even ESP® will not be able to prevent an accident!
Electrically adjustable and heated exterior mirrors
For optimal rearward visibility, Mercedes-Benz Vans are equipped with large, low-vibration exterior mirrors. The electrically adjustable and heated versions of these mirrors can be quickly adjusted from the driving seat – an important bonus when there are frequent driver changes – and ensure a clear view to the rear in winter weather.
